What is the part of speech adaptations and answer?

Let's break down "adaptations" and "answer" to determine their parts of speech:

* Adaptations: In this context, "adaptations" is a noun. It refers to the changes or modifications made to something to suit a new purpose or environment.

* Answer: "Answer" can be multiple parts of speech, depending on how it's used in a sentence. Here's a breakdown:

* Noun: "Answer" is a noun when it refers to the response to a question or query. For example: "What is the answer to the question?"

* Verb: "Answer" is a verb when it means to respond to a question or request. For example: "Can you answer the phone?"
